While many of the characters suggest sketch-comedy inspiration, and some of the jokes are standard-issue (Saturday Night Live famously spoofed the New York City subway's unintelligible public address system a generation ago), somehow that doesn't make them less funny. Janssen-Faith and McGowan aren't trying to reinvent the screeching steel subway wheel here. They're using the microcosmos of the underground train to make us look closely at ourselves - and to laugh at what we see, which may be what we need the most.Coffee Cup (a theatre co.) presents Standing Clear at The Access Theater, 380 Broadway, 4th floor (no elevator), through June 21.
